New starter checklist — shuttle-bus gate. On day one, walk the new starter to Gate 4 at the rear of the Ostrey Park campus, where the Fernhollow shuttle picks up. Shuttles run every 20 minutes from 07:30. The gate turnstile does not accept visitor passes, so reception must issue the starter a temporary pass before their first ride. Remind them the gate locks at 19:00. Until their permanent badge arrives, they should use the temporary gate code below.

door code, yagap-bahof: bdg-O-05

## Runbook: Flagwright Rollout

Promote flags in Flagwright only after the canary cohort holds steady for 30 minutes. If error budget dips, freeze the ramp and revert to the last stable percentage. Never edit cohort rules mid-ramp. Kill switch lives in the admin plane; use it before debugging. Active rollout parameters are listed below.

deployment values, kajep-kageg:
[praix]
host = praix.paliqcorp.corp
user = praix_svc
database = praix_prod

### Sizing the Proselint-9 rule engine

So, why hard caps at all? Early versions of Proselint-9 happily chewed through 40MB generated changelogs and timed out the CI job for everyone at Hatterfield. Lesson learned: the linter bounds file size, rule fan-out, and per-file wall time, and anything over budget gets flagged rather than scanned. Future maintainers, please resist raising these without profiling first. The current budgets live here.

constants for tageg-kagag:
QUOTAS = {
    "kelax": 495,
    "istath": 366,
    "tammir": 108,
    "novdor": 730,
    "casax": 816,
    "quenael": 874,
    "pelius": 403,
}

Finance Review Summary — Revised Commission Scheme

Welcome aboard! Here's the short version on the new sales-commission scheme before your first leadership meeting. We moved from flat 5% to a tiered model: 3% to target, 8% above it, with a quarterly accelerator on the Solvane product line. Early data shows payout costs roughly flat but top-performer retention improving. Clawback rules now cover cancellations within 90 days. To understand why we structured it this way, read the confidential planning note appended below.

board note of bawep-tajef: Queniusek Systems plans to raise the Quenvan list price by 53.1 percent in March. The pricing group signed off on a budget of $176.4 million for Project Drueth. The renewal with Casionix Partners closes at $142.5 million a year, 8.3 percent below the last contract. Project Fraax slips by six weeks because of the tooling delay.